logo

Output ea574005adbb276dd9f60b618d6a401b533ae6eea139210e9e38e4af33f06166:22

value
2680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26fc138128ee54b9490c93ce1d64c1ffda470c3a OP_EQUAL
address
35F9aPoiAXA1Ns33qRCKzmCX1EcaKkzfzD
transaction
ea574005adbb276dd9f60b618d6a401b533ae6eea139210e9e38e4af33f06166